用户偏好禁止偷偷重定向并显示警告:
然而,这种偏好的程度似乎仅限于
<META http-equiv="refresh" content="0;URL=http://www.dollarade.com/noscript.php">
这类偷偷摸摸的重定向,恶意网页可以通过使用以下方式轻松绕过此限制:
<script type="text/javascript" language="javascript">if (!hasloaded) { window.location = 'http://www.dollarade.com/adblock.php'; }</script>
所以,问题是:是否有高级设置(about:config 可能是?)来重新控制 JavaScript 驱动的偷偷重定向?
如果有人好奇更多信息:这里这是用户的投诉和来自外部的示例页面。请注意 Firefox 是如何由于偷偷重定向而忽略历史记录条目的,这使得研究有问题的页面非常不方便。
答案1
你不一定能够使用内置控件来修改 Firefox 处理此特定功能的方式,但你当然可以下载附加组件,例如无脚本这将限制 Javascript 重定向您的能力(以及 Javascript 可能尝试执行的几乎所有其他操作)。